Smoking cessation: Congratulations on having quit. It may take some time to get over the cravings. Try using the nicotine gum to get you through a rough period. Use carrot or celery sticks to simulate having a cigarette in your mouth/fingers. Your doctor might prescribe a course of Chantix to block the nicotine cravings if all else fails. Good luck with your endeavor.
